Biography
Edwin was born in 1869.
He married Alberta Haas 7 Sep 1889 in Womelsdorf, Berks, Pennsylvania.[1]
At the time of the 1930 census he was living with his wife and children in West Reading, Berks, Pennsylvania, United States.
